CVE-2025-7025

Rockwell Automation Arena Simulation is affected by CVE-2025-7025, a memory abuse/heap-based buffer overflow in Arena Simulation triggered when a user opens a malicious DOE file. The flaw can allow reading/writing past allocated memory, potentially enabling code execution or information disclosur...
